Open Combat - Stuart - 27-02-2015 Open Combat is a recent set of historical/fantasy skirmish rules that Gav Thorpe is involved with. They've just launched a kickstarter to fund a print run. https://www.kickstarter.com/projects/590134953/open-combat-miniature-skirmish-game-rulebook?ref=email Quote:Open Combat has been available digitally since October 2014 in PDF format from the Second Thunder website (and has been well received by those playing it - more on that later). The aim of this Kickstarter is to fund a printed edition of the rules, helping to expand the reach of the game to gamers that prefer physical books over digital products.
